Speaking to ANI on the anti-swarm drone ammunition, Commander Indian Navy, MN Pasha said, "The speciality of this ammunition is it has 300 steel balls, on detonation, it will spread and create a wall of balls and it will destroy the drones. It is highly effective and completed lab trials."
